Patent number: 12292522Abstract: Techniques and apparatuses are described for determining a position of user equipment by using adaptive phase-changing devices. In aspects, a base station transmits wireless signals for a UE toward respective reconfigurable intelligent surfaces (RISs) of adaptive phase-changing devices. The APDs may direct reflections of the wireless signals in a direction, such as toward the UE, based on a configuration of the RIS of the APD. The base station receives, from the UE via a wireless connection, identifiers of the reflections of the wireless signals that are received by the UE. In some cases, the base station also receives a signal quality parameter associated with the reflection reaching the UE. The base station determines angular information based on the respective identifiers and/or signal quality parameters of the reflections. Based on the angular information and known positions of the APDs, the base station determines a position of the UE.Type: GrantFiled: July 15, 2021Date of Patent: May 6, 2025Assignee: Google LLCInventors: Jibing Wang, Erik Richard Stauffer

Patent number: 12294730Abstract: A pruning method of neural network based video coding of a current block of a picture of a video sequence is performed by at least one processor and includes categorizing parameters of a neural network into groups, setting a first index to indicate that a first group of the groups is to be pruned, and a second index to indicate that a second group of the groups is not to be pruned, and transmitting, to a decoder, the set first index and the set second index. Based on the transmitted first index and the transmitted second index, the current block is processed using the parameters of which the first group of the groups is pruned.Type: GrantFiled: June 20, 2023Date of Patent: May 6, 2025Assignee: TENCENT AMERICA LLCInventors: Xiaozhong Xu, Wei Jiang, Shan Liu, Wei Wang

Patent number: 12294790Abstract: An imaging device may include an image sensor that generates frames of image data in response to incident light with an array of image pixels, and processing circuitry that processes the image data. The processing circuitry may include a transformation circuit that applies transforms to subsampled frames of image data that are generated using a subset of the image pixels to produce transform values, and a comparator circuit that compares the transform values. The processing circuitry may determine that motion has occurred between sequential frames if a difference between a first transform value corresponding to a first image frame and a second transform value corresponding to a second image frame exceeds a threshold value. In response to determining that motion has occurred, the image sensor may generate full-frame image data using all of the pixels of the array of image pixels.Type: GrantFiled: August 7, 2023Date of Patent: May 6, 2025Assignee: SEMICONDUCTOR COMPONENTS INDUSTRIES, LLCInventors: Alexander Lu, Kuang-Yen Lin

Patent number: 12294183Abstract: A clamp mechanism for an RF cluster connector enables multiple RF connections within a cluster connector to be engaged and disengaged in such a way that prevents damage to the conductors. It also eases the process of engaging and disengaging through the use of two lever arms that may be easily used by a technician in challenging locations (such as at the top of a cell tower) and in densely arranged RF ports (such as for a multi-user or massive MIMO antenna).Type: GrantFiled: May 5, 2022Date of Patent: May 6, 2025Assignee: John Mezzalingua Associates, LLCInventors: Thomas Urtz, Jeremy Benn, Christopher Natoli
